| POWER TRAIN - A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ION | ||||||||||||||||
| 98V069002 | CHRYSLER CORPORATION | from 05/15/1989 to 02/02/1998 | V (Vehicle) | 42214 | 07/06/1998 | ODI | CHRYSLER GROUP LLC | 04/07/1998 | 06/16/1998 | |||||||
| Defect Summary | Vehicle description: passenger vehicles. lockup of the transfer case can occur due to insufficient lubrication. | |||||||||||||||
| Consequence Summary | This condition can cause a loss of vehicle control, increasing the risk of a crash. | |||||||||||||||
| Corrective Summary | Dealers will inspect the vehicles for adequacy of the transfer case oil volume, transfer case oil leakage, and operational degradation of the transfer case mechanism. if oil volume is insufficient, the appropriate amount of oil will be added. if there is transfer case oil leakage, affected components will be replaced. if the transfer case shows operational degradation, the transfer case will be replaced. | |||||||||||||||
| Notes | Owner notification began july 6, 1998.owners who take their vehicles to an authorized dealer on an agreed upon service date and do not receive the free remedy within a reasonable time should contact chrysler at 1-800-992-1997. also contact the national highway traffic safety administration's auto safety hotline at 1-888-dash-2-dot (1-888-327-4236). | |||||||||||||||
